Sheri Thompson
Oversees all aspects of Walker & Dunlop’s multifamily and healthcare lending through HUD
Has worked to help reshape the company’s approach to diversity & inclusion
Founding board member, Real Estate Network Empowering Women
Sheri Thompson is EVP and FHA finance group head at Walker & Dunlop, based in the company’s Bethesda, MD headquarters. She oversees all aspects of one of the nation’s top 5 (2020) multifamily lending through the U.S. Department of Housing and Urban Development (HUD).
With more than 25 years of experience working within the commercial mortgage banking industry, Thompson is well known for her deep insight, values, integrity, and creativity. She keeps both the finer details and broader picture in focus when working on complex transactions and always invites perspectives other than her own.
As a leader, Thompson is described as collaborative and open, and strengthens her team daily through openness and trust. She is a role model and mentor to many and is actively involved in industry affinity groups for women in CRE, military families, and affordable housing. Colleagues say Thompson is passionate about building meaningful relationships and supporting others, which differentiates her and is making a lasting impact on everyone she interacts with.
These are just a few of the reasons we chose Thompson as one of the Washington, DC 2021 Women in Real Estate Award winners.
